Why Keyword Research Matters for Bloggers
Understanding what your audience is searching for is the key to creating relevant content. Effective keyword research helps:
- Improve SEO: Identify keywords that can increase your chances of ranking on the first page of search results.
- Establish Content Strategy: Guide the topics you write about based on audience interest and search intent.
- Attract Targeted Traffic: Draw visitors who are genuinely interested in the content you provide, increasing engagement and conversions.
1. Understanding Different Types of Keywords
Bloggers should familiarize themselves with various keyword types to create a comprehensive strategy:
- Short-Tail Keywords: These are general keywords (e.g., "travel tips") that usually have high search volumes but are highly competitive.
- Long-Tail Keywords: More specific phrases (e.g., "best travel tips for solo female travelers") that usually have lower competition and a more targeted audience.
- LSI Keywords: Latent Semantic Indexing keywords are related terms that enhance the context of your content (e.g., "travel safety", "packing tips").
2. Tools for Effective Keyword Research
Several tools can streamline your keyword research process:
- Google Keyword Planner: A free tool that provides keyword suggestions and search volume data.
- Ubersuggest: Offers keyword ideas, search volume, and competitive analysis.
- Ahrefs: A premium tool that provides in-depth keyword analysis, including keyword difficulty and SERP rankings.
- Answer the Public: Generates questions and phrases that people commonly search alongside your keyword.
3. Analyzing Competitors
Studying competitors can reveal valuable insights into keyword opportunities. Consider:
- Check their top-performing blog posts for keywords.
- Analyze their content strategy and discover gaps you can fill.
4. Crafting Content Around Keywords
Once you have a list of targeted keywords, it's essential to integrate them naturally into your content. Here are some tips:
- Utilize Keywords in Titles: Ensure your primary keyword appears in the blog post title.
- Use Keywords in Subheadings: Incorporate secondary keywords in H2 and H3 headings for better SEO.
- Maintain Natural Flow: Write for readers first; the keywords should fit seamlessly into your content.
